随着数字货币的快速发展,硬件钱包作为一种安全存储和管理数字资产的方案,逐渐受到越来越多用户的青睐。Ledger作为行业领导者之一,其硬件钱包的设计与开发无疑为用户提供了安全、高效的解决方案。本文将深入探讨Ledger硬件钱包的开发过程,包括其技术架构、安全性设计、用户体验以及未来的发展趋势,帮助开发者和用户更深入地理解硬件钱包领域。

一、Ledger硬件钱包的基本架构

Ledger硬件钱包的基本架构由多个关键部分组成,包括硬件设计、固件开发以及支持的软件应用。硬件设计不仅涉及到物理设备的外观和用户交互,还要考虑其安全性能。Ledger设备通常采用高级安全芯片,这种芯片能够有效防止各种攻击,确保用户私钥的安全。

在固件开发方面,Ledger使用了一种名为BOLOS的操作系统,这是一种专为安全设备设计的操作系统。BOLOS允许在Ledger硬件上运行多个应用程序,而这一切都在严格的安全环境中进行。此外,Ledger还提供了开发工具,如SDK(软件开发工具包)和API(应用程序接口),以帮助开发者创建和管理应用程序。

支持软件应用则包括Ledger Live等,这些应用程序使用户能够轻松地管理他们的数字资产,同时提供了简单易用的界面。Ledger Live允许用户在不同设备上备份和恢复其钱包,查看交易历史,以及进行资产交换等功能。

二、Ledger硬件钱包的安全性设计

安全性是Ledger硬件钱包最重要的特性之一,Ledger为保护用户资产采取了多层次的安全措施。这些措施包括物理安全、数据加密、隔离执行和安全认证等多种方法。

首先,在物理安全方面,Ledger硬件钱包采用了安全芯片,这种芯片集成了多种安全功能,如硬件加密和防篡改机制。即便恶意用户试图接触硬件钱包,都会被芯片内置的安全机制检测到并迅速做出反应。

其次,在数据加密方面,Ledger使用非对称加密技术来保护用户私钥。这意味着用户的私钥从未离开硬件设备,因此即便是连接到不受信的计算机,用户的私钥依然是安全的。此外,Ledger还支持使用PIN码和恢复种子,大大增强了安全性。

值得一提的是,Ledger硬件钱包实现了“隔离执行”功能,这意味着所有的敏感操作都在安全环境中进行,并与普通操作隔离开。通过这种方式,Ledger提高了设备抵御各种网络攻击的能力,确保用户的数字资产不受损失。

最后,安全认证也是Dashboard中不可忽视的一部分。Ledger硬件钱包与多种区块链平台和服务提供商建立了安全认证,确保用户在进行交易时能够确认交易的合法性和安全性。他们还定期进行安全审计和测试,以确保其安全措施始终在行业领先水平。

三、用户体验在Ledger硬件钱包中的重要性

用户体验是金融科技产品成功与否的重要因素之一。Ledger十分重视用户体验,通过多种方式简化操作和增强用户交互,为用户提供无缝且安全的使用体验。

首先,在设计上,Ledger硬件钱包具有简洁的用户界面,用户可以轻松浏览和管理其数字资产。多种语言支持使得全球范围内的用户都可以方便使用。此外,清晰的操作指引和常见问题解答,使新用户能够快速上手,避免操作误区。

其次,Ledger Live应用程序为用户提供了一站式管理功能,用户可以在一个界面中完成账户管理、资产查看、交易记录等多种操作。这种一体化的设计不仅提升了效率,也为用户提供了更好的管理体验。

此外,Ledger还与多家交易所和DApp(去中心化应用)进行了集成,用户可以直接通过Ledger Live进行资产交易。这种便捷的操作极大地提升了用户的使用体验,使得资产管理不再是繁琐的过程。

当然,客户服务也是用户体验的重要组成部分。Ledger致力于为用户提供优质的客户支持,解决他们在使用过程中遇到的各种问题。通过社区论坛、在线帮助和帮助中心等多种渠道,Ledger用户能够快捷地获取所需的帮助和支持。

四、Ledger硬件钱包的未来发展趋势

随着区块链技术的日益成熟,硬件钱包行业也将面临更多挑战与机遇。未来,Ledger可能会在以下几个方面进行发展与创新:

首先,Ledger可能会增强对新兴区块链和加密资产的支持。随着越来越多的项目和货币涌现,用户对多币种钱包的需求日益增加。Ledger已有意扩展其支持的币种,以此满足用户不断变化的需求。

其次,随着DeFi(去中心化金融)的兴起,Ledger可能会开发更多与DeFi相关的功能和应用,让用户能够更安全地参与到去中心化金融市场中。此外,Ledger还可能与更多的协议和DApp进行集成,为用户提供更加丰富和多样化的体验。

其次,在用户体验方面,Ledger未来也有可能进行更多的创新。通过数据分析和用户反馈,Ledger将不断其产品,使之更符合用户需求。例如,基于人工智能的辅助功能可能会逐渐集成进Ledger硬件钱包中,从而改善用户的决策过程。

最后,安全性依然是Ledger未来开发的重中之重。Ledger可能会持续研发更先进的安全技术,以应对越来越复杂的网络攻击。同时,Ledger还可能会与安全研究机构进行更多合作,共同提升硬件钱包及其生态系统的安全性。

相关问题探讨

硬件钱包的优势与劣势

硬件钱包在数字资产管理中具备显著的优势,包括高水平的安全性、离线存储、以及复原性等。然而,它也并非完美,存在一定的劣势。

优势方面,首先是安全性。相比软件钱包,硬件钱包将私钥存储在物理设备中,避免了因网络攻击导致的资产失窃可能性。其次,离线存储大幅度降低了黑客攻击成功的可能性。第三,硬件钱包通常支持多种加密货币及应用,用户可以一站式管理不同资产。

然而,硬件钱包也存在劣势。第一是价格,硬件钱包通常价格偏高,并非所有用户都乐于为此支付。第二是易用性,虽然UX/UI有所提升,但相对软件钱包而言仍有一定学习曲线。第三,依赖物理设备的特性意味着失去或损坏设备将会导致一定的资产风险,因此备份和恢复措施必不可少。

开发Ledger硬件钱包需要哪些技能

开发Ledger硬件钱包需要一整套的技能组合,从硬件设计到固件开发,再到用户体验的,都是不可或缺的环节。

首先,硬件设计方面,开发者需要具备电子工程学和微控制器的知识,了解怎样设计和制作安全的硬件组件。接下来,在固件开发上,熟悉C/C 编程语言及安全操作系统(如BOLOS)是关键。此外,了解加密算法和安全协议对数据保护至关重要。

其次,开发者还需要具备跨平台开发技能,能够创建跨设备通信与应用程序的管理界面,比如使用JavaScript、HTML等进行应用界面开发。同时,良好的项目管理技能和协作能力也非常重要。

最后,持续学习新兴技术,对于新技术的敏感度及适应能力将为开发者与时俱进提供可能,建立在新时代的网络安全基础上。

Ledger硬件钱包的竞争与合作

在硬件钱包市场竞争激烈,Ledger面临来自其他厂商的压力,如Trezor、KeepKey等。这些竞争者不断推出新的产品和功能,试图吸引用户。

然而,Ledger也意识到单靠竞争无法长久,合作和联盟的战略开始逐渐受到重视。例如,Ledger与多种主流加密交易所进行合作,不仅能够为客户提供直接交易的便利性,还能增强用户对Ledger品牌的信任。此外,Ledger也可能与其它区块链项目进行技术合作,丰富其生态系统和用户体验。

用户在使用Ledger硬件钱包时应注意哪些安全事项

用户在使用Ledger硬件钱包时,需遵循一些安全操作,以确保其资产的安全性。例如,用户在购买硬件钱包时,应确保通过官方渠道进行购买,以防购买到被篡改或伪造的设备。

其次,务必要设定一个复杂的PIN码,并定期更换,这样可以降低恶意用户对钱包的访问风险。此外,用户还应妥善保存恢复种子,不将其存储在方便被盗取的地方。

另外,在连接到计算机时,确保计算机及其操作系统是干净的,并始终保持Ledger设备的固件是最新版本,以享有最佳的安全防护。

通过以上探讨,相信读者对Ledger硬件钱包的开发、应用以及未来趋势有了更深刻的了解。在快速变化的数字货币世界中,保持对安全性和用户体验的关注是最后的关键。